Firms have been more and more utilizing AI’s picture era chops to show individuals pictures abilities. Google final 12 months launched a characteristic referred to as Camera Coach on Pixel phones to information customers about framing and composition, and in July, Adobe launched a brand new characteristic in its experimental digital camera app to make use of AI to critique photos and suggest changes for capture.

On the identical slant, two former TikTok staff, Melody Chu and Jing Liu, are launching a brand new iOS app referred to as Superpose that makes use of an AI information to show individuals the best way to pose for photos.

Superpose basically is a digital camera app. Customers can take a selfie or photograph of a pal, and the app will generate 4 potential poses utilizing AI. A few of the poses are extravagant, and at instances, the era appears uncanny.

Customers can save generated poses, or use the match pose characteristic to attempt to place themselves within the body based mostly on its solutions.

Previous to founding Superpose, Chu labored in varied product roles in firms like Meta, Nextdoor, Roblox, TikTok, and Slack. In the meantime, Liu was a founding engineer at a 3D face-scanning startup, and later labored on picture and video fashions at TikTok.

Chu mentioned that the concept for the app stemmed from a private drawback: her husband wasn’t in a position to take good pictures of her.

“My husband simply takes terrible pictures of me. It was a real ache level in our marriage the place I don’t perceive how he will get me to look simply so horrible on a regular basis. And I assumed to myself, there must be a option to resolve this drawback with developments in pc imaginative and prescient and generative AI. And I made a decision to set out by myself,” Chu advised TechCrunch.

Superpose was launched in July, and has been downloaded over 22,000 instances thus far. The corporate says its customers have generated greater than 190,000 poses. The app provides customers 5 generations without cost day-after-day, however they will purchase a pack of 5 extra generations for $2.99, or 20 generations for $9.99.

Whereas Chu acknowledged that different firms are additionally coming into the AI-guided pictures house, she mentioned Superpose desires to give attention to changing into the very best digital camera to take portrait pictures by following instructions from AI. The startup doesn’t wish to get into creating AI backgrounds and pictures, and desires to give attention to real-life images, she added.

“We wish to lean into the core of reminiscence seize versus, say, placing you in a fantastical place that you just’ve by no means been. I feel there are such a lot of apps that try this effectively already, however we actually wanna give attention to truly capturing the lived second and expertise,” Chu mentioned.

She additionally acknowledged that among the pose solutions might sound uncanny, and the corporate is engaged on bettering that. The startup says it’s engaged on bettering its era kinds, personalization, and methods to higher coach customers straight from the viewfinder.

Superpose has raised $2.2 million in funding from Khosla Ventures, Chinese language smartphone and selfie app maker Meitu, and OVTR Ventures.
